Well I just got a new quest, i love it. The Board however, is being a pain in the ass. It doesnt read shots correctly, and if I'm corrrect in reading the manual/interpreting LED colors, it is burning the living shit out of my batteries.

I heard this is a common problem. The rest of the internals/lpr/bolt seem 100% fine. So do you guys think that it is soley a board problem and replacing the board with a different one would remedy the problem?

was is junk, and I would personally dump it if I were you. you may have one of the boards that needs to be reflashed, as there was a bug in the code, contact fep to see if this is the case. It was supposed to have been corrected on all the new guns, but you never know.

I know it sucks to get a new marker and have issues like this, but trust me it's just the board. The quest itself is the best all around gun I have owned. As for a different board, I personally have been pretty happy with the lucky board, tough to beat for the price.

yea WAS is shit and you got one of the original boards that drains batteries like a bitch. You can either go with a reflashing of the board, or get a lucky or virtue board depending on your money situation.
